To give you a little bit of background on my wife's car.
It was bought in 2002 with 30 000km from Auto Alpina in Boksburg.
I paid R360 000 for the car and it was the best money I have spent having enjoyed 205 000trouble free kms. The car gets oil serviced every 7 000km with synthetic oil and has the rest done as per BMW service intervals.
Last year one of teh head gaskets decided to give up through old age as the car did not overheat but it seems to have blown a gasket and it was mixing oil in the water without overheating.
It is my intention to do the head work as well as new cam chains and guides.
I shall equally take the gearbox valve body to ZF for them to give it an overhaul as the car lately started holding gears on the odd occasion.

Front bumper removed. If anyone wants to know how please ask.
Radiator removed along with a few other things
Engine harness disconnected from control boxes. That is a most simple procedure as everything is either plug specific or terminal specific so you cannot go wrong in just unplugging things.
I love the way that BMW have constructed the e38 it is as strong as a Bull and here gents I am not reffering to the Blue Bulls.
I removed the fuel rail from the Injectors as it is a lot easier to do then to remove the injector plugs first and then remove the fuel rail with the injectors attached.
